Key Cost Factors
- Unit Type and SEER Rating: High-efficiency units, like those from Lennox with SEER ratings up to 26.00, can have a higher upfront cost but may offer significant savings on utility bills over time.
- System Size (Tons): The tonnage of the AC unit (e.g., a 2.5-ton unit) needs to be appropriately matched to your home's square footage, impacting both the unit price and installation complexity.
- Ductwork Condition: If existing ductwork needs extensive repair, replacement, or new installation, it will add to the overall cost. For example, a Reddit user in nearby Metro Atlanta reported paying $9400 for "new everything besides ducts" indicating how ducts can be a separate cost factor.
- Brand and Features: Premium brands like Lennox often come with advanced features and higher associated costs compared to more budget-friendly options.
- Complexity of Installation: Factors like accessibility, modifications to existing electrical systems, or the need for custom solutions can increase labor costs.
- Permits and Inspections: Local regulations in Lenox, GA, may require permits for AC installation, which adds to the overall project cost.

Tips for Hiring
- Get Multiple Quotes: Always gather several estimates from reputable AC contractors in the Lenox area. This allows you to compare pricing and ensure you're getting a competitive rate for the scope of work.
- Verify Credentials: Ensure the contractor is licensed and insured. Ask for references and check online reviews to gauge their reputation and quality of service.
- Understand the Proposal: A detailed quote should break down the costs for the unit, labor, materials, and any additional services. Don't hesitate to ask questions if anything is unclear.
- Inquire About Warranties and Guarantees: Understand the warranty on both the AC unit and the installation itself. A good warranty provides peace of mind in case of future issues.
